summaryrefslogtreecommitdiff
path: root/lang/ossp-js/patches/patch-af
blob: 8cc790975d6ac319ea19104f4bc791c501e39798 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
$NetBSD: patch-af,v 1.1 2008/04/04 01:56:16 bjs Exp $

--- src/jsapi.c.orig	2007-02-08 04:39:05.000000000 -0500
+++ src/jsapi.c
@@ -4078,7 +4078,7 @@ JS_EvaluateScript(JSContext *cx, JSObjec
     JSBool ok;
 
     CHECK_REQUEST(cx);
-    chars = js_InflateString(cx, bytes, &length);
+    chars = js_InflateString(cx, bytes, (size_t *)&length);
     if (!chars)
         return JS_FALSE;
     ok = JS_EvaluateUCScript(cx, obj, chars, length, filename, lineno, rval);
@@ -4097,7 +4097,7 @@ JS_EvaluateScriptForPrincipals(JSContext
     JSBool ok;
 
     CHECK_REQUEST(cx);
-    chars = js_InflateString(cx, bytes, &length);
+    chars = js_InflateString(cx, bytes, (size_t *)&length);
     if (!chars)
         return JS_FALSE;
     ok = JS_EvaluateUCScriptForPrincipals(cx, obj, principals, chars, length,